The sample contains a Document_Open macro that utilizes CreateObject to initiate a PowerShell stager. This stager is heavily obfuscated but appears to be designed to download and execute a second-stage payload. The presence of a hidden UserForm and the obfuscated PowerShell command strongly indicate a downloader or droppper functionality.

  • Hidden UserForm PowerShell EncodedCommand stager critical OLE_USERFORM_OBFUSCATED_POWERSHELL
    OLE document contains a UTF-16LE form/property string with an obfuscated PowerShell -EncodedCommand payload. The observed macro family reconstructs this hidden string with Split/Join or UserForm property reads and launches it through WMI/COM process creation. This is downloader malware, not an Office CVE exploit.
